Cheng Shao-Chieh (traditional Chinese: 鄭韶婕; simplified Chinese: 郑韶婕; pinyin: Zhèng Sháojié; Wade–Giles: Cheng Shao-chieh; born 4 January 1986 in Taipei, Taiwan, Republic of China) is a female badminton player from Republic of China.
William Frullani (born September 21, 1979 in Prato) is a decathlete and bobsleigh competitor from Italy.
Fleur Nicolette Andrea van de Kieft (born October 22, 1973 in Amsterdam) is a former field hockey striker from the Netherlands, who played 137 official international matches for Holland, in which she scored a total number of 44 goals.
Hélène Prévost was a French tennis player at the end of the 19th century. She won the French Open Women’s Singles Championship in 1900.
Joel Jordison (born March 11, 1978) is a Canadian curler from Moose Jaw, Saskatchewan. Jordison currently skips his own team from Moose Jaw.
Martin Braud (born January 6, 1982 in Angoulême, Charente) is a French slalom canoer.

Vilimaina Davu (born 15 January 1977 in Nadi, Fiji) is a Fijian and New Zealand netball player, who has represented both countries in international netball as a goal keeper. She has also played basketball at an international level.
Marta Gega (born 16 April 1986) is a Polish handballer who plays for MKS Lublin and the Polish national team.
Emanuel Alexis Moriatis (born January 19, 1980 in Lanús, Buenos Aires province) is an Argentine (of Greek origin) racing driver. He won the Turismo Carretera championship in 2009, and the Turismo Nacional Clase 3 championship in 2012.
Adhemar Grijó Filho (born October 18, 1931 in Santa Catarina) was a Brazilian sportsman. He competed in three Olympics. He represented Brazil in swimming at the 1952 Olympics and in water polo at the 1960 and 1964 Olympics.
